一、what 變量就是用來存儲數據的容器 二、how 通過var 關鍵字定義一個變量 變量的賦值:通過賦值運算符“=” 給變量賦值。 注意: 1.如果想要比較兩個變量是否相同,不能使用“=”進行比較。 2. ...
快速復習 在JavaScript中交換變量的 種方法 許多算法需要交換 個變量。在編碼面試中,可能會問您 如何在沒有臨時變量的情況下交換 個變量 。我很高興知道執行變量交換的多種方法。在本文中,您將了解大約 種交換方式 種使用額外的內存,而 種不使用額外的內存 。 .解構賦值 解構賦值語法 ES 的功能 使您可以將數組的項提取到變量中。例如,以下代碼對數組進行解構: let a let b a, ...
2020-08-19 11:31 0 523 推薦指數:
一、what 變量就是用來存儲數據的容器 二、how 通過var 關鍵字定義一個變量 變量的賦值:通過賦值運算符“=” 給變量賦值。 注意: 1.如果想要比較兩個變量是否相同,不能使用“=”進行比較。 2. ...
參考:Copying Objects in JavaScript - Orinami Olatunji(@orinamio_) October 23, 2017 直接將一個變量賦給另一個變量時,系統並不會創造一個新的變量,而是將原變量的地址賦給了新變量名。舉個栗子 ...
對於兩種變量的交換,我發現四種方法,下面我用Java來演示一下。 1.利用第三個變量交換數值,簡單的方法。 (代碼演示一下) 2.可以用兩個數求和然后相減的方式進行數據交換,弊端在於如果 x 和 y 的數值過大的話,超出 int 的值會損失精度。 (代碼 ...
轉至:https://blog.csdn.net/weibo1230123/article/details/82085226 在shell中變量的賦值有五種 :使用 read 命令,直接賦值,使用命令行參數,使用命令行的輸出結果,從文件讀取 1. 直接賦值,格式為:變量名 = 變量 ...
前面的話 數組總共有22種方法,本文將其分為對象繼承方法、數組轉換方法、棧和隊列方法、數組排序方法、數組拼接方法、創建子數組方法、數組刪改方法、數組位置方法、數組歸並方法和數組迭代方法共10類來進行詳細介紹 對象繼承方法 數組是一種特殊的對象,繼承了對象Object ...
Python中四種交換兩個變量的值的方法 方法一:(所有語言都可以通過這種方式進行交換變量) 通過新添加中間變量的方式,交換數值. 下面通過一個demo1函數進行演示: 方法二:(此方法是Python中特有的方法) 直接將a, b兩個變量放到元組中,再通過元組 ...
在進行開發時,往往需要對兩個整數變量進行交換,可采用以下三種方法: 1、借助臨時變量; 此種方式比較好理解,在開發時可直接使用。但在面試中使用,似乎顯得低端。 2、借助“先加后減”操作,不生成臨時變量。 使用此種方法時,注意加減的次序。 另外一點,有人說在使用 ...
在開發過程中又是我們需要對值進行交換。一般我們都在用一種簡單的解決方案:“臨時變量”。不過還有更好的辦法,而且不只有一個,有很多。有時我們在網上搜尋解決方案,找到后復制粘貼,但是從沒想過這小段代碼是怎樣工作的。現在我們該學習一下應該怎樣輕松高效地交換值了。 1 使用臨時變量 先是最簡單 ...